Abstract

The utility model relates to the technical field of air humidification equipment, in particular to an air humidification component and an air purification and humidification integrated machine, the air humidification component comprises a water tank, an evaporation component and a wind shield, an annular surrounding plate is arranged in the water tank around a bottom air inlet, the annular surrounding plate is matched with the water tank to form an annular water sump, the evaporation component comprises an annular evaporation cylinder made of wet film materials, the evaporation cylinder is inserted in the annular water sump and sleeved outside the annular surrounding plate, the upper part of the evaporation cylinder is higher than the annular water sump, and the wind shield covers the top of the evaporation cylinder, so that air flow can pass through the evaporation cylinder to humidify air flow; the air purification humidification all-in-one includes air purifier and above-mentioned air humidifying subassembly, and the air humidifying subassembly is installed on air purifier and the air inlet of air humidifying subassembly is linked together with air purifier's air outlet. The utility model has the advantages that: the humidifying device has the advantages of large humidifying amount, no pollution to furniture, convenient maintenance, low cost, household space saving, cleanness and safety.

Background
In a household environment, particularly in three seasons of summer, autumn and winter, the indoor environment is dry, and air needs to be humidified. At present, the traditional humidifier mostly adopts an ultrasonic humidifying working principle, water is beaten into small water drops and then blown out by a fan, and the mode has the advantages that firstly, the humidifying quantity is small, secondly, harmful substances such as bacteria and the like in the water are easily and directly absorbed by a human body, and thirdly, the small water drops easily fall on furniture to cause furniture scale; fourthly, the atomizing piece is a vulnerable device with a service life, needs to be replaced regularly, and is high in maintenance cost. In addition, along with the improvement of the living standard of people, a plurality of families also need to use the air purifier, so that the air humidifier and the air purifier need to be purchased at the same time by the families, the cost is high, and the air humidifier and the air purifier both need to occupy certain household space.

Example 1:
as shown in fig. 1 to 8, an air humidification assembly 1 includes a water tank 11, an evaporation assembly and a wind shield 12, the water tank 11 is provided with an air inlet 111 and an air outlet 112, the air inlet 111 is disposed on a bottom plate of the water tank 11, the water tank 11 is internally provided with an annular surrounding plate 113 around the air inlet 111, an outer side wall of the annular surrounding plate 113, an inner side wall of the water tank 11 and the bottom plate of the water tank 11 are surrounded to form an annular water sump 114, the evaporation assembly includes an annular evaporation cylinder 13 made of a wet film material, a lower portion of the evaporation cylinder 13 is inserted into the annular water sump 114 and sleeved outside the annular surrounding plate 113, an upper portion of the evaporation cylinder 13 is higher than the annular water sump 114, the wind shield 12 covers the top of the evaporation cylinder 13 and is abutted against each other, and a mounting seat 14 for connecting.
The below of deep bead 12 still is equipped with the water collector 15 of an annular structure, water collector 15 is through connecting annular bounding wall 113's support 16 hangs and locates the top of air inlet 111, deep bead 12 is the high conical surface structure that hangs all around of a centre, thereby the outer edge of water collector 15 meets the lower surface with deep bead 12 and makes the water droplet of deep bead 12 lower surface can the landing in water collector 15, still is equipped with a guiding gutter 151 on the water collector 15, and the other end slant downwardly extending of guiding gutter 151 reaches the top of annular sump 114 to make ponding in the water collector 15 can the water conservancy diversion to in the annular sump 114.
The lower surface of the wind deflector 12 is provided with an annular connecting ring 121, a plurality of first clamping pieces 122 are arranged on the connecting ring 121 at intervals, a second clamping piece 152 corresponding to the first clamping piece 122 is arranged on the outer edge of the water pan 15, the outer edge of the water pan 15 is in clamping connection with the lower surface of the wind deflector 12 through the first clamping piece 122 and the second clamping piece 152, the wind deflector 12 rotates relative to the water pan 15 to enable the first clamping piece 122 and the second clamping piece 152 to be clamped or separated, the upper surface of the wind deflector 12 is further provided with a mark 123 for marking the clamping or separating state, the wind deflector 12 is convenient to open or lock through the design, and when the wind deflector 12 is opened and detached, the evaporation cylinder 13 can be directly replaced or maintained.
The side wall of the water tank 11 is provided with a spillway hole 115 and a corresponding hole cover, the height of the spillway hole 115 is slightly lower than the upper edge of the annular surrounding plate 113, when the water in the annular water bin 114 is excessive, the water can be discharged from the spillway hole 115, so that the water is prevented from overflowing and flowing to the air inlet 111.
Air outlet 112 is established the top of water tank 11, air outlet 112 department still is equipped with first air-out net 17, first air-out net 17 demountable installation in the top of water tank 11.
The upper surface of the mounting seat 14 is provided with two insertion connectors 144, the bottom of the water tank 11 is provided with an insertion groove 116 matched with the insertion connectors, the mounting seat 14 is provided with an air guide cylinder 141 inserted into the air inlet 111, the outer diameter of the air guide cylinder 141 is smaller than the inner diameter of the annular enclosing plate 113, so that the air guide cylinder 141, the annular enclosing plate 113 and the mounting seat 14 are matched to form a water collecting tank, and the mounting seat is further provided with a water drainage tank 142 for draining water in the water collecting tank. When the water tank is used, the water tank can be directly placed on the mounting seat, and the two plug-in connectors 144 are plugged in the plug-in grooves 116 for positioning. By providing the water collection groove, the water accidentally flowing out of the water tank 11 can be collected and discharged by the water collection groove of the mount, thereby preventing it from flowing out of the air inlet 111 to the air cleaner.
Two quick-release fixing rods 143 are disposed on two sides of the mounting seat 14, the quick-release fixing rods 143 penetrate through the mounting seat 14 and can rotate relative to the mounting seat 14, the upper ends of the quick-release fixing rods 143 are knobs 1431 and are hung and buckled on the mounting seat 14, and the lower ends of the quick-release fixing rods 143 are slender hanging buckles 1432. Example 2:
as shown in fig. 9-10, an air purifying and humidifying integrated machine comprises an air purifier 2 and an air humidifying assembly 1 in embodiment 1, wherein an air outlet of the air purifier 2 is arranged at the top, the air humidifying assembly 1 is installed at the top of the air purifier 2 through an installation seat 14, and an air inlet 111 of the air humidifying assembly 1 is communicated with the air outlet of the air purifier 2, so that air purified by the air purifier 2 can be exhausted after being humidified by the air humidifying assembly 1.
Air purifier 2's air outlet department is equipped with grid shape second air-out net 21, and during the use, on air purifier 2's air outlet was placed to the mount pad, the second air-out net 21's grid can be passed to hang knot 1432 of hanging of quick detach dead lever 143 lower extreme, can make mount pad 14 and air purifier 2 carry out the high-speed joint through rotating quick detach dead lever 143.
The water tank 11, the mounting seat 14 and the air purifier 2 are of columnar structures with the same cross section size, so that the air purifying and humidifying all-in-one machine formed by serially assembling the water tank 11, the mounting seat 14 and the air purifier 2 is of an integral structure with a coherent section outline, and is compact and reasonable in structure, convenient to install and attractive in appearance.
The air purifier 2 in the embodiment can select various air purifiers in the prior art, and the technology of the air purifier is mature, so the specific structure and the working principle of the air purifier are not explained in detail and limited in detail, and the air humidifying assembly 1 in the embodiment 1 can be adaptively adjusted in appearance and connection structure according to the selected air purifier.
When in use, the air humidifying assembly 1 in embodiment 1 is installed at the air outlet of the air purifier 2, and the air purified by the air purifier 2 enters from the air inlet 111 of the air humidifying assembly 1, then passes through the side wall of the evaporation cylinder 13, so that the moisture absorbed by the evaporation cylinder 13 is evaporated and vaporized to humidify the air flowing through, and then is discharged from the air outlet 112.
